Transaction 65021431b153e14be90424380080aff3f3fbb548d964462c6ccf79d24a2a8139
1 Input
1 Output
-
65021431b153e14be90424380080aff3f3fbb548d964462c6ccf79d24a2a8139:0
- value
- 20199657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a318e50d5f47c36da6ba4ca5158fe818f4edaf6 OP_EQUAL
- address
- 345Wrjhqy6v5MtB1Z64DQowU3zbiCuXRsR